My family (me, DH, 2 kids) are traveling with my parents. Our plan was to purchase 1 AP in my name and get the resort AP discount on 2 connecting rooms. I made the reservations under my name. I have not yet purchased the AP, but certainly planned to do so well in advance of our trip. My problem is that my family was planning on purchasing three 5 day hopper passes (plus the one AP). We figured IF we decided to do a water park, we would just purchase a separate 1 day ticket. My father wanted to get a LOS (or whatever they're calling it now). My mother has no intention of going to the parks on a daily basis. A 5 day hopper is more than enough for her. I just read that the LOS passes have to be purchased by EVERYONE in the party. Does that mean all 6 of us, since the reservation is in my name, or can it be just my parents since they are in their own room? It would be ridiculous for all of us to pay for the LOS passes since we will not use them. One option would be for the AP holder to be my father instead of me, but I've already made the reservation and paid the deposit in my name. Is it easy to just transfer the name of the reservation, or would I have to cancel, refund my deposit and rebook?
Thanks in advance for any help.
 
I know that they don't mind if some people have LOSs and others have APs. Lots of people on these boards have been able to get that combination. I wouldn't be surprised if they would give your dad a LOS, but you would probably have to buy it when you get to the resort, not ahead of time.
 
We went in June and 4 had AP and 3 did not, we were all in the same room (2bedroom at Boardwalk) and there was no problem. If you have separate rooms there should be even less of a problem. But you will probably have to wait until check in.

Something to consider is also what you will do on future trips. I purchased an AP for myself on our last trip and 7-day plus for my DH and girls. We did not plan a water park visit that trip but I thought we would do one sometime. We ended up doing an additional trip in Feb and had enough days on their passes for those days and we still have all of our plus passes left. I bought them AP's this year and we will use the plus passes with those on our next trips. I don't do the water parks but DH and the girls will.

The only advantage to the LOS pass over the hoppers is that it includes Disney Quest, depending on the length of your stay even a 7-day pass is less expensive and may allow your FIL to enjoy the parks everyday as he wants. On the 8th day an AP is the cheapest per day in the park but that is the regular AP that does not include the water parks.

I put all my ticket options in an excel spreadsheet and calculated the price per day, also consider that the days and plusses never expire so you can use them later too.

Just another suggestion - have you considered getting him an AP? I don't believe the AP has to be in your name to get the discount on rooms or you could have his name added to the reservation. An AP is cheaper than $391 and he can come and go to the parks all he wants. If his real interest is the parks this is a great option, he may even decide to go back again within the year since his admission is already covered.
